Transaction 6428d817869a2182bec4c891a54a52e83a8f21f2226ceac8e8733f7de607fa53

3 Input
2 Outputs
  • 6428d817869a2182bec4c891a54a52e83a8f21f2226ceac8e8733f7de607fa53:0
  • value  2473690
    address  1MR78y7q63JDGYEFKRvvJqcZUow49GrM4C
  • 6428d817869a2182bec4c891a54a52e83a8f21f2226ceac8e8733f7de607fa53:1
  • value  157258
    address  3Kyd9stLCPLASPvT24jt39TUzF74h394Ug